International Association of Venue Managers

IAVM is a trade association representing those who manage public assembly venues

Based in TX

🤖

AI Overview

With $660K in lobbying spend across 25 quarterly filings, International Association of Venue Managers is an active lobbying client. Their lobbying covers 8 issue areas. Active from 2020 to 2025.

What They Lobby About

These are actual descriptions from their quarterly lobbying disclosure filings, summarizing what they lobbied Congress and federal agencies about.Issue areas: Disaster Planning, Labor Issues, Budget/Appropriations, Small Business, Arts/Entertainment and 3 more

  • Review of the ASCAP and BMI Consent Decrees by the U.S. Department of Justice
  • Legislative actions in response to COVID-19 and disaster assistance
  • Ability of small business venues to participate in the Paycheck Protection Act of the CARES Act - H.R. 748
